Will Klopp come to Real? A new era is expected in Madrid.

In recent days, European media have been extensively discussing reports about Jurgen Klopp being appointed as the head coach of Real Madrid. This was reported by Zamin.uz.
Although this information has not yet been officially confirmed, the ideas about "a new era beginning in Madrid" are becoming increasingly realistic. Currently, Alvaro Arbeloa is also mentioned as another candidate for the Real team.
However, questions are being raised about his insufficient experience as a coach, especially regarding the potential difficulty in managing a star-studded squad. Such a lack of experience could potentially harm the team under great pressure.
Additionally, there are opinions that the young coach's influence on the team leaders is not yet sufficient. At this point, according to well-known journalist Ekrem Konur, if Jurgen Klopp becomes Real's head coach next season, he may demand the sale of two players from the squad.
These players are forward Rodrigo and midfielder Eduardo Camavinga. It is said that Rodrigo does not want to leave the club, but if he does not fit into the new coach's plans, the situation may change.
His transfer value is currently estimated at around 60 million euros. Regarding Camavinga, the transfer price is expected to start at least from 50 million euros.
If Klopp comes to Real, it is expected not only to be a coaching change but also to bring significant changes to the team roster. Now the main question is whether these reports will remain just rumors or if major changes will really take place in Madrid this summer?
